Roof vent flashing repair services involve inspecting and restoring the protective barriers installed around roof vents. These flashings create a weather-tight seal between the vent pipe or box and the roofing material, preventing water from seeping into the attic or interior spaces. Over time, exposure to the elements can cause the flashing to deteriorate, crack, or shift, leading to vulnerabilities. Repair services typically include replacing damaged sections, resealing joints, and ensuring the flashing is properly aligned to maintain its waterproof integrity.
Addressing roof vent flashing issues helps to prevent common problems such as leaks, water damage, and mold growth. When flashing fails, water can infiltrate the roofing system, leading to rotting of roof decking, insulation damage, and potential structural concerns. Repair services aim to restore the flashing’s effectiveness, reducing the risk of costly repairs down the line and helping to maintain the overall health of the roof and the property.

Cost Range - Roof vent flashing repair typically costs between $150 and $400 per vent, depending on the extent of damage and materials needed. For example, replacing a standard metal flashing might be around $200, while more extensive repairs could reach $350 or more.
Material Costs - The price of materials for vent flashing repairs varies, with common options costing between $20 and $80 per piece. Higher-end or custom flashing materials may increase the overall repair costs accordingly.
Labor Expenses - Labor fees for vent flashing repairs generally range from $75 to $150 per hour, with total costs depending on the complexity of the job. Simple repairs may take a few hours, while more involved work could cost more.
Additional Factors - Costs can fluctuate based on roof pitch, accessibility, and local labor rates. Extra repairs or replacement of surrounding roofing components might add to the total expense, with some projects reaching $500 or higher.
Actual totals will depend on details like access to the work area, the scope of the project, and the materials selected, so use these as general starting points rather than exact figures.

What is roof vent flashing repair? Roof vent flashing repair involves fixing or replacing the metal or waterproof seal around roof vents to prevent leaks and ensure proper ventilation.
How do I know if my roof vent flashing needs repair? Signs include water stains on ceilings, visible rust or damage around vents, or increased energy costs indicating ventilation issues.
Why is proper flashing important for roof vents? Proper flashing prevents water infiltration, protects the roof structure, and maintains effective ventilation for the building.
What types of roof vents may need flashing repair? Common types include bathroom exhaust vents, attic vents, and roof intake vents, all of which rely on flashing to keep them sealed.
